Struct google_compute1::api::ResourcePolicyResourceStatus[][src]

pub struct ResourcePolicyResourceStatus {
    pub instance_schedule_policy: Option<ResourcePolicyResourceStatusInstanceSchedulePolicyStatus>,
}

Contains output only fields. Use this sub-message for all output fields set on ResourcePolicy. The internal structure of this "status" field should mimic the structure of ResourcePolicy proto specification.

This type is not used in any activity, and only used as part of another schema.

Fields

instance_schedule_policy: Option<ResourcePolicyResourceStatusInstanceSchedulePolicyStatus>

[Output Only] Specifies a set of output values reffering to the instance_schedule_policy system status. This field should have the same name as corresponding policy field.

Trait Implementations

impl Clone for ResourcePolicyResourceStatus[src]

impl Debug for ResourcePolicyResourceStatus[src]

impl Default for ResourcePolicyResourceStatus[src]

impl<'de> Deserialize<'de> for ResourcePolicyResourceStatus[src]

impl Part for ResourcePolicyResourceStatus[src]

impl Serialize for ResourcePolicyResourceStatus[src]

Auto Trait Implementations

impl RefUnwindSafe for ResourcePolicyResourceStatus[src]

impl Send for ResourcePolicyResourceStatus[src]

impl Sync for ResourcePolicyResourceStatus[src]

impl Unpin for ResourcePolicyResourceStatus[src]

impl UnwindSafe for ResourcePolicyResourceStatus[src]

Blanket Implementations

impl<T> Any for T where
    T: 'static + ?Sized
[src]

impl<T> Borrow<T> for T where
    T: ?Sized
[src]

impl<T> BorrowMut<T> for T where
    T: ?Sized
[src]

impl<T> DeserializeOwned for T where
    T: for<'de> Deserialize<'de>, 
[src]

impl<T> From<T> for T[src]

impl<T> Instrument for T[src]

impl<T, U> Into<U> for T where
    U: From<T>, 
[src]

impl<T> ToOwned for T where
    T: Clone
[src]

type Owned = T

The resulting type after obtaining ownership.

impl<T, U> TryFrom<U> for T where
    U: Into<T>, 
[src]

type Error = Infallible

The type returned in the event of a conversion error.

impl<T, U> TryInto<U> for T where
    U: TryFrom<T>, 
[src]

type Error = <U as TryFrom<T>>::Error

The type returned in the event of a conversion error.